WATR 157 - Water Treatment II

Institution:
Citrus College
Subject:
Water Technology
Description:
Strongly recommended: WATR 156. A course covering water resources, water quality, unit operations of advanced water treatment systems, public health, water chemistry and microbiology, and fluoridation. Prepares students for T3, T4, and T5 Water Treatment Operator's Certificate examinations required by the Department of Public Health. 54 hours lecture.
